House Sitting in Australia

The true spirit of house sitting is a free exchange of services that benefits both side – house sitters get free accommodation in exchange for the caring for homes, pets and gardens, whilst homeowners can rest assured all is being looked after whilst they are away.

The search for reliable house sitters for house sitting and pet sitting assignments is aided by pet sitting sites like Oz House Sitters, which facilitate a safe meeting place for pet house sitter and home owner.

Located in the Southern hemisphere and home to wonders, such as the Great Barrier Reef, Wave Rock, Ayers Rock, the Devil’s Marbles and the legendary Outback, Australia offers adventure and excitement to all who visit.
With fantastic beaches, first-class wineries, unique wildlife and great rock art, there is something for each and everyone to discover. Whether your thinking of house sitting in New South Wales, Queensland, Victoria, South Australia, Tasmania, Western Australia, the Northern Territory, or the Australian Capital Territory, Australia offers house sitters an electrifying experience.

Where can I House Sit in Australia?

House Sitting Australian Capital Territory

ACT is home to Canberra, the capital of Australia. Located approximately 3 hours south west of Sydney, the population is near 396,000 people primarily in the government, and military sectors. The city is surrounded by the Namadgi National Park and Tidbinbilla Nature Reserve to the west and world class wineries to the north.

House Sitting New South Wales

The laid-back outdoor lifestyle and natural beauty of New South Wales makes it a great place to do some house sitting! The South coast provides unspoiled beauty and the North Coast provides top surfing locations with top national parks.

Among top tourist attractions are the Sydney Harbour Bridge, the Blue Mountains, the Snowy Mountains, Byron Bay and Bondi Beach – attractions made famous all around the world. There are many site seeing attractions in Sydney, places such as the Rocks, the Zoo, the Botanic gardens, Bondi Beach, Fort Denison and Kings Cross.

House Sitting Northern Territory

The Northern Territory is the base of the Australian Outback, offering an unforgettable experience and relaxed lifestyle. The multicultural city of Darwin is a great place to go and relax, see plenty of crocodiles or take one of the many tours on offer.

House Sitting Queensland

Queensland, is the second largest state in the country as well as the third most populated. Brisbane is the capital city and home to more than one third of the entire states population, meaning there are plenty of house sitting opportunities within Brisbane and it’s surrounding suburbs. A few hours south of Brisbane is the Gold Coast, which is full of excellent surfing beaches, theme parks, luxury houses and resorts. Further to the north, you’ll find Townville, a cosmopolitan city, in the heart of the tropics with the Great Barrier Reef on its doorstep. In the Far North of Queensland is Cairns, a tropical city of over 150,00 residents and a hub for tourism to northern Queensland and the Outback.

House Sitting South Australia

South Australia is a well kept secret situated along the southern coast of Australia. The South Australian Coastline is exceptionally beautiful, varying from pristine beaches to high cliff sides. Popular attractions include: Kangaroo Island, Flinders Ranges, Yorke Peninsula, Murray River and the Limestone Coast. The capital of South Australia is Adelaide. Adelaide is known for its old style culture and ancient looking stone buildings that give the city a prestigious nature. Just an half hour drive from the city center are picturesque hills and beaches to enjoy.

House Sitting Tasmania

Tasmania is a small island that is located south of Australia, approximately 200 kilometers south of Victoria. Tasmania is the smallest of Australia’s states. Dense rainforests, mountain peaks, alpine meadows, great lakes, eucalyptus stands and fertile stretches of farmland are all easily accessible. Hobart, the capital city, offers plenty of house sitting opportunities.

House Sitting Victoria

Despite being the second smallest state of Australia, Victoria is one of the most populated states in Australia. Melbourne, the capital of Victoria and about 75% of the state’s population call the city home. Melbourne is a buzzing metropolis with a distinctly multicultural flavour and a vibrant arts and cultural scene. The city centre is intertwined with a maze of narrow laneways brimming with intimate cafes (Melbourne is also famous for good coffee), bars and boutique stores.

House Sitting Western Australia

Western Australia is about one third of the size of the country and is Australia’s largest state. It has a total size of close to 2,500,000 square kilometers and takes up a whopping third of the entire country. The capital city Perth is said to be the most beautiful city in the country.
